Environmental engineers design and execute solutions to prevent pollution and clean up contaminated sites. They apply engineering principles to tackle waste treatment, water quality issues, and soil remediation. Their daily work involves analyzing environmental problems, selecting appropriate treatment methods, and overseeing implementation. They might design filtration systems, plan hazardous waste disposal, conduct soil testing, or monitor air quality. Environmental engineers work across industries, from manufacturing facilities to construction sites, protecting public health and ensuring compliance with environmental regulations.

Two NCEES exams: the FE early in your career and the discipline-specific PE after four years of qualifying experience.
You'll take a two-part exam. The national section tests your core engineering knowledge and applies across all states. The state-specific section covers local laws and regulations you need to know in your jurisdiction. Most states contract with testing vendors like PSI, Pearson VUE, or Prometric to administer both portions. You typically sit for these exams at a testing center, not online. Each section has its own passing score, and you need to pass both to earn your license. Your state board will specify the exact score requirements and whether you can retake failed sections separately.

Strong candidates for the electronics engineer role combine the technical knowledge tested on the exam with judgment and communication skills you build through supervised experience.
You'll need two distinct skill sets to succeed as an electronics engineer. First, the technical foundation: circuit design, signal processing, systems analysis. You'll acquire this partly through formal study and partly through hands-on projects. But technical knowledge alone won't get you far. You also need practical judgment, knowing when to cut corners safely and when precision matters most. Strong communication matters too. You'll explain design choices to non-engineers, troubleshoot problems with teammates, and document your work clearly. These softer skills develop through real projects under experienced mentors, not textbooks.
